Singing River Electric linemen to help Magnolia Electric Power with post-tornado power restoration

Singing River

After working long hours on Saturday restoring power during the extreme wind event, Singing River Electric linemen are traveling this afternoon to Magnolia Electric Power based in Summit, Miss. after tornadoes caused extensive damage.

Magnolia Electric reports having 270 broken poles. Their outage number is relatively low at 1,297, but changing out that many poles and restringing the power lines to restore service is a massive task.

The towns of Tylertown, Progress, and Salem are in Magnolia Electric’s service area.
